CHAN 2024: Senegal’s Malick Fires Warning Ahead of Clash with Nigeria
As the 2024 African Nations Championship (CHAN) heats up, Senegal’s midfielder El Hadj Malick has boldly declared that his team is ready to defeat Nigeria’s Home-based Super Eagles.
Speaking ahead of their crucial encounter, Malick expressed strong confidence in his side’s preparation and commitment to defending their CHAN title, which they won three years ago in Algeria.
“We are determined. We know that people back home in Senegal expect a lot from us,” Malick said, highlighting the weight of national expectations on the team’s shoulders.
Senegal, coached by Souleymane Diallo, is aiming to retain their crown and prove their dominance once again on the continental stage.
The much-anticipated clash between these two West African giants is set to take place tonight at the Amman Stadium in Zanzibar, marking the first-ever CHAN showdown between Senegal and Nigeria.
Football fans across the continent will be watching closely as both sides battle for supremacy and a shot at CHAN glory.
